Cübbeli Ahmet Hoca

Cübbeli Ahmet Hoca

religious leader Turkey

Cübbeli Ahmet Hoca, whose real name is Ahmet Mahmud Ünlü, is a prominent Turkish Islamic cleric and television personality known for his controversial views and public prayers. He has garnered a significant following through his sermons and media appearances, often addressing contemporary social and political issues from an Islamic perspective. Recently, he was in the news following a public dispute with Ersin Tatar, the former President of Northern Cyprus, regarding a prayer he offered, which Tatar claimed negatively impacted his electoral performance. Cübbeli defended himself by stating that Tatar had sought his prayers, leading to a heated exchange and a public revelation of past communications between the two.
